> > Bluetooth: Broadcom Blutonium firmware driver ver 1.0
> > bcm203x_probe: Mini driver request failed
> > bcm203x: probe of 1-1:1.0 failed with error -5
> > usb 1-1: bulk timeout on ep1in
> > usbfs: USBDEVFS_BULK failed dev 3 ep 0x81 len 10 ret -110
>
> these are two different errors. The first is from bcm203x while the
> request of the firmware file through request_firmware() fails and the
> second is form the bluefw program. Maybe hotplug get's into to trouble
> and tries to load the bcm203x and bluefw at the same time while it also
> has to handle requesting of the firmware file with firmware.agent. Does
> it work for you if you uninstall bluefw.

That is why I removed all the bluefw stuff in /etc/hotplug before
testing bluetooth again... but it still oopsed.
